http://www.npc.gov.cn/englishnpc/c23934/202409/c79ddaa265f745c895ad97db2df8912e.shtml WebTax laws and regulations must be comprehensible to the taxpayer; ... Frequent changes to tax laws can result in reduced compliance or in behaviour that attempts to compensate for probable future changes in the tax code—such as stockpiling liquor in advance of an increased tariff on alcoholic beverages. The year of assessment runs from April 1 to March 31. For profits tax purposes, the basis period is the accounting year of the taxpayer ended in the year of assessment. Hong Kong taxpayers are prompted to file tax returns.
